Summary of Position

Ensuring all paper flow and record keeping for the service department is completed and administered properly and efficiently. Administering all aspects of the warranty claim flow including claim writing, warranty parts return, warranty account reconciliation, and warranty appeals. Processing technician payroll information. Working with the Service Manager on day to day operations of the service department. Assisting with job scheduling, customer communication, and inventory tracking and flow.

Duties & Responsibilities

Inventory management - tracking of machinery & attachments that are entering and leaving the yard including checking fuel & hour usage.
Maintain and manage all machine traffic.
Traffic machine Demo, Rental or Loaners back into system same day as return.
Open work orders according to return type once trafficked in.
Complete outbound traffic requests immediately after receiving.
Communicate with sales department with questions or concerns.
Record and report any machine damage per Rental, Demo, Loaner Damage Process.
Ensure machine was returned full of fuel. If not inform sales manager prior to filling.
Check machine serial number for open PIPs that require completion and inform Service Manager. Create work order, also check to ensure another store does not have a work order open for that PIP. If so consult with appropriate store.
Check machine maintenance records for required service intervals. If required inform Service Manager and create work order.
Check warranty status of machine. If issues found during shop check-in, ensure they are warranty items. If required create separate warranty work order for machine repair.
Perform weekly yard inventory reports at minimum. Resolve any disputed findings on report immediately. If machines are not found utilize JD-Link to locate.
Creates & tracks service work orders.
Tracks warranty progress.
Process payroll for all technicians.
Maintains fuel report.
Communication link between the technician and the customer.
Works with 3rd party trucking companies when loading & unloading equipment.
Operates machines & helps with the loading & unloading of trucks as necessary.
Performs all other duties as assigned.
